The valknut (pronounced “val-knoot”) is another one of the most prominent symbols associated with Viking culture. It often appears in both old and new features of viking artwork and artefacts.

Many depictions of Odin feature his two ravens by his side, this is in fact a telltale sign that the figure that is being depicted is in fact the Allfather. As Norse deity was one to welcome the heroes slain in battle to Walhalla, several Northman tombs contained Odin-related figurines with the Valknut image drawn simply beside them.

Viking Symbols and the Meanings Behind Them

During the Viking age the Norsemen had a complex system of religious and cultural beliefs with different aspects of their belief system being represented in their artwork, weaponry, ships and jewelry as a number of different symbols, each of which had its own unique meaning. Since the world of Norse Mythology was so complex with many Gods and other mythical creatures having their own distinct qualities it is not surprising then that there were also a large number of different symbols to represent the different aspects of these characters.

As was the case with many civilisations throughout history a great number of these symbols predate the culture itself and were adopted or adapted from earlier symbols that were commonly used prior to the Viking age and throughout the European continent.
